The Huawei Mate 30 is a little bit better than Samsung Galaxy XCover 5, with an 84 score against 78.1. Huawei Mate 30 is an older and heavier cellphone than Samsung Galaxy XCover 5, but Huawei managed to build it a little thinner anyway. Both of these phones work with Android OS (Operating System), but Huawei Mate 30 has the previous 10 version while Samsung Galaxy XCover 5 has Android 11.
Huawei Mate 30 counts with a bit better looking screen than Galaxy XCover 5, because it has a way better resolution of 1080 x 2340 pixels, a greater pixel amount per screen inch and a bigger display. Galaxy XCover 5 features a much greater memory capacity to install applications and games or saving photos and videos than Huawei Mate 30, because although it has only 64 GB internal memory, it also counts with an external memory card slot that allows up to 1 TB.
Huawei Mate 30 counts with just a bit better hardware performance than Samsung Galaxy XCover 5, and although they both have a Octa-Core CPU, the Huawei Mate 30 also has a larger amount of RAM. Huawei Mate 30 shoots greater photos and videos than Samsung Galaxy XCover 5, and although they both have the same diafragm aperture, the Huawei Mate 30 also has a much higher 3840x2160 video definition and a way more mega pixels camera.
The Huawei Mate 30 counts with a way better battery lifetime than Samsung Galaxy XCover 5, because it has a 40 percent greater battery size.
